The Jerusalem Center for Public Affairs, published a report which examines Anti-Semitic cartoon content used in some of the major progressive sites, such as Mondoweiss, The Daily Kos and Indymedia. Some of the content of these blogs pointed out in this report is short of startling. The sites use “political cartoons: to reinforce negative stereotypes against Jews. The cartoons cloak their Antisemitism in a veil “anti-Israelism.”

This is not in any way to suggest that all anti-Israel expressions are anti-Semitic, but it is clear that these cartoons have crossed the line. The cartoons show Jews or Israelis as being Nazis trying to paint Jews as the ultimate evil and at the same time diminishing the evil of the Holocaust. Other illustrations try to perpetuate the anti-Semitic canard that Jews control the world, or the blood libel about Jews using Gentile children to satisfy some imagined blood-lust.

All this is happening despite the fact that these blogs publish policies which expressly prohibit content which contains, “hateful” or “inflammatory” content, most of the time, these hate cartoons are not removed from these sites.
